WebJust an alternative perspective since a lot of people don't like the idea of a prenup for emotional reasons: Everyone signs a prenup. By getting legally married without writing your own prenup, you choose to sign the prenup written by the laws of that state. Same with dying without a will. Asset division plans Because Kentucky is WebJan 2, 2013 · A prenuptial agreement is not enforceable in Pennsylvania if the party opposing the agreement can establish, by clear and convincing evidence that: The party did not execute the agreement voluntarily. A party may argue fraud, duress or coercion, which are contract principles, ...
